A SUMMER VERY MUCH ABOUT SUSTAINABILITY AND TERRITORY-BASED ECONOMY: DUCA DI SALAPARUTA IS KEY PARTICIPANT AT CONVENTIONS ON THE SEASON’S HOT TOPICS

In June we had the opportunity to speak at two important AMORIM conventions that were held in Sicily.
The first one, on “Sustainability in Winemaking”, took place at the Duca di Salaparuta Cellars in Casteldaccia (Palermo) on June 16th.

The various speakers included Claudia Piccinini Duca di Salaparuta Food Quality and Safety Assurance Manager – who talked in detail about the value of the VIVA and Equalitas Certifications (both of which Duca di Salaparuta obtained last year), indispensable for tracing the path to follow when it comes to applying sustainability in the winemaking sector.

 The second convention, titled MOTORE ITALIA Sicily edition: restarting from the island’s finest products, took place on June 20th at the Hotel Villa Igiea in Palermo. Promoted by Class Editore, it was devoted entirely to the small and medium-size businesses that keep the country going. As a member of the panel on Hospitality and Ecotourism, Roberto Magnisi – Director of Duca di Salaparuta Cellars – spoke about his hands-on experience.
